How they compare

Belgium currently reports 10.49 terawatt-hours against 10.45 terawatt-hours in Austria, a difference of 0.04 terawatt-hours.

The two have swapped places 2 times across 36 shared years of data; in 1990 it was Belgium ahead.

Austria ranks 27th and Belgium ranks 26th of 79 countries.

Across the 4 decades both report, Austria averaged higher in 1 and Belgium in 3.

Head to head by decade

Decade Austria Belgium Difference Ahead
1990s 0.001 terawatt-hours 0 terawatt-hours 0.001 terawatt-hours Austria
2000s 0.0197 terawatt-hours 0.0218 terawatt-hours 0.0021 terawatt-hours Belgium
2010s 0.8471 terawatt-hours 2.71 terawatt-hours 1.86 terawatt-hours Belgium
2020s 5.68 terawatt-hours 7.42 terawatt-hours 1.74 terawatt-hours Belgium

Averages of every year both report within each decade.
